  • Abstract
    PURPOE: To report a cae of caterpillar etae embedded in the corneal troma and inferotemporal retina with minimal inflammation. DEIGN: Obervational cae report. METHOD: A 4-year-old boy developed a red eye after playing with a caterpillar. He wa placed on topical tobramycin/dexamethaone and referred for evaluation of embedded etae in hi conjunctiva, cornea, iri, and retina. Examination revealed no iridocycliti or vitriti. REULT: Becaue of the lack of intraocular inflammatory repone, no invaive intervention wa conducted to remove or detroy the etae and he wa tapered off the tobramycin/dexamethaone. At 4-month follow-up he remained aymptomatic with the etae till preent in both hi cornea and retina. In addition, vitreou membrane had formed in the immediate vicinity of the intraretinal etae. CONCLUION: Intraretinal and corneal etae can be embedded with minimal inflammation and can be tolerated without need for urgical intervention.
